
Java Digest #35
evertimes 7 минут назад Java Digest #35 Простой 12 мин 11 Блог компании Т-Банк Java * Программирование * Дайджест Всем привет! 👋👋👋👋👋Мы — Java-разработчики Т-Банка: Андрей, Арсений, Роман, Константин и Константин....
Anthropic — What company has the best second artificial intelligence model at the end of June?
В сфере искусственного интеллекта произошло заметное событие. evertimes 7 минут назад Java Digest #35 Простой 12 мин 11 Блог компании Т-Банк Java * Программирование * Дайджест Всем привет! 👋👋👋👋👋Мы — Java-разработчики Т-Банка: Андрей, Арсений, Роман, Константин и Константин. Собираем интересные новости, статьи, туториалы и другие материалы из мира Java-разработки и делимся этим со всем сообществом.
В этом выпуске рассказываем, когда ждать релиз Java 27 и как Oracle планирует регулировать использование генеративного ИИ при написании кода. Посмотрим детальное интервью о Spring Framework 7 и Spring Boot 4 с самой командой создателей Spring. Почитаем, как безопасно работать с нативной памятью в многопоточной среде с помощью VarHandle.
Технические детали
А еще изучим любопытный постмортем, посвященный расследованию раздувания памяти в контейнерах после перехода на JDK 17. Горячий JEPJEP 534: Compact Object Headers by Default. Компактные хедеры будут по умолчанию.
Напомним, что компактные хедеры добавили в JDK 24, в JDK 25 они стали полностью доступны с помощью флага XX:+UseCompactObjectHeaders, а теперь их хотя включить по умолчанию. Компактные хедеры занимают 64 бит памяти вместо 96, за счет чего уменьшается объем используемого хипа. Джавовые события29 августа в штаб-квартире Т-Банка пройдет JVM Day — конференция для бэкенд-разработчиков.
Идет сбор заявок на доклад для тех, кто хочет рассказать о рабочих кейсах, новых подходах или необычных практиках. Главные новостиOpenJDK Interim Policy on Generative AI. OpenJDK выложили временную политику по использованию генеративного ИИ.
Отраслевые последствия
Полную обещают выложить позже. Если коротко, то пока запретили любое использование ИИ на ресурсах OpenJDK. Помимо кода в репозиторий, любую информацию или картинки на ресурсах OpenJDK нельзя генерировать.
При этом можно с помощью ИИ анализировать код OpenJDK и на основе анализа производить доработки руками. Объявлен график выхода JDK 27. Марк Рейнхольд официально объявил расписание для JDK 27.
Rampdown Phase One (форк от main) назначена на 4 июня 2026, GA — на сентябрь 2026. Из нацеленных JEP'ов: JEP 532 (Primitive Types in Patterns, пятое preview). Напомним, что JDK 27 не будет LTS-релизом, следующий LTS после JDK 25 ожидается в JDK 29.
Этот прогресс даёт важные сигналы о будущем отрасли, и технологический мир внимательно наблюдает.





